Not Installing Your Dish Washer Properly Can Result In a Mountain of Problems
Not just can setting up a dishwasher correctly void your warranty, but it can likewise create a mess. As an example, if you do not install the supply line correctly, you might handle leaks-- and even worse, a flooding. You may likewise exper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s as well rapidly via your pipelines as well as causes loud trembling sounds. If you inaccurately install your dishwashing machine to the garbage disposal, you may discover poignant scents or have deposit on your recipes.

A Plumber Can Check the Supply Lines
A supply line, particularly a dishwashing machine adapter, links the dishwashing machine to a water source. If you acquire a new supply line, a plumber can ensure that the line works with both your dishwashing machine as well as water resource. A professional plumber can evaluate it to make certain that it's in excellent problem as well as does not have any type of leakages if you choose to use an existing supply line.

S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ION
If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.
If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per.
